Mission

The municipal information systems association of California (misac) was founded in 1980 out of a need for collaboration and data sharing. The organization consists of three chapters: central, northern and southern, while also offering informational and formal sub-regional specialization. The chapters are managed by regional boards which gives them greater influence in their respective regions. Our membership includes IT professionals from cities, towns, public safety, special districts, and other local governmental agencies/districts. the misac state board of Directors manages the direction of the association as a whole via our state bylaws and four pillars.
